First edition of this baseball legend’s autobiography. Octavo, original cloth. Presentation copy, signed by Roger Maris and inscribed by co-author Jim Ogle on the front free endpaper. Very good in a very good dust jacket. Rare and desirable signed.

Roger Maris (1934–1985) was an American professional baseball player best known for breaking Babe Ruth’s single-season home run record by hitting 61 home runs in 1961, a feat that stood for decades as one of the sport’s most iconic achievements. Playing primarily for the New York Yankees, Maris exemplified both exceptional athletic skill and personal restraint, navigating the immense pressures of media scrutiny and public expectation during an era of expanding sports celebrity.
